Transaction 7501e70220443c6fcb7c25e79b819bb29ca67b376f14326dd10e1be02c8f8bc1

block
f874678080f0f2cec18c7b63542f24802446ccdacf1ce842b0fe57117016b531

29 Inputs

2 Outputs